ASV-10.000MHZ-E-T Details

  • Manufacturer Part Number:

    ASV-10.000MHZ-E-T

  • Pbfree Code:

    Yes

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Package Description:

    ROHS COMPLIANT, HERMETIC SEALED, SMD, 4 PIN

  • Country Of Origin:

    Mainland China

  • Factory Lead Time:

    12 Weeks

  • Manufacturer:

    Abracon Corporation

  • YTEOL:

    5

  • Additional Feature:

    POWER DOWN; TRI-STATE; ENABLE/DISABLE FUNCTION; TR

  • Fall Time-Max:

    5 ns

  • Frequency Adjustment-Mechanical:

    NO

  • Frequency Stability:

    100%

  • JESD-609 Code:

    e4

  • Mounting Feature:

    SURFACE MOUNT

  • Number of Terminals:

    4

  • Operating Frequency-Nom:

    10 MHz

  • Operating Temperature-Max:

    70 °C

  • Operating Temperature-Min:

    -20 °C

  • Oscillator Type:

    HCMOS/TTL

  • Output Load:

    10 TTL, 15 pF

  • Physical Dimension:

    7.0mm x 5.08mm x 1.8mm

  • Rise Time-Max:

    5 ns

  • Supply Voltage-Max:

    3.63 V

  • Supply Voltage-Min:

    2.97 V

  • Supply Voltage-Nom:

    3.3 V

  • Surface Mount:

    YES

  • Symmetry-Max:

    40/60 %

  • Terminal Finish:

    Gold (Au) - with Nickel (Ni) barrier
